Iraqi Army Launches Operation to Liberate Tal Afar from ISIS

Alwaght- Iraqi army has launched a large-scale operation to liberate Tal Afar city from ISIS terrorist group, the Defense Ministry said on Tuesday.

Spokesman for Iraq’s Defense Ministry, announced that the country's Air Force began the liberation operation by conducting airstrikes on ISIS positions in the northern city of Tal Afar.

Mohammed al-Khudari stressed that the ground offensive to retake Tal Afar, located 70 kilometers west of Mosul, will start following the completion of those strikes.

Following the start of the offensive, a local source said that six large explosions rocked several areas in Tal Afar. One of the blasts reportedly hit a workshop used to manufacture explosives in the west of the city.

ISIS occupied Tal Afar, which has a population of around 200,000, in 2014. According to Major General Najim Abdullah al-Jubouri , Commander of Mosul Offensive, there are an estimated of 1500-2000 ISIS terrorists holed up in Tal Afar.

A high-ranking official of the Iraqi Popular Mobilization Forces (PMF), also known by the Arabic name Hashd al-Shaabi, said on Monday that the pro-government fighters will actively participate alongside other security forces in the operation to liberate the Tal Afar.

PMF also played active role in Mosul Liberation Operation to liberate Mosul from ISIS early last month, following a two-phased Iraqi military offensive, which first began in October 2016.
